Should you be buying Brookfield Reinsurance stock or one of its competitors? The main competitors of Brookfield Reinsurance include Prudential Public (PUK), Sun Life Financial (SLF), Willis Towers Watson Public (WTW), Principal Financial Group (PFG), Corebridge Financial (CRBG), Brookfield Wealth Solutions (BNT), Equitable (EQH), Aegon (AEG), Everest Group (EG), and Ryan Specialty (RYAN). These companies are all part of the "insurance" industry.

Brookfield Reinsurance (NYSE:BNRE) and Prudential Public (NYSE:PUK) are both large-cap finance companies, but which is the superior stock? We will contrast the two companies based on the strength of their media sentiment, institutional ownership, profitability, analyst recommendations, risk, dividends, earnings and valuation.

Prudential Public has higher revenue and earnings than Brookfield Reinsurance. Prudential Public is trading at a lower price-to-earnings ratio than Brookfield Reinsurance, indicating that it is currently the more affordable of the two stocks.

7.2% of Brookfield Reinsurance shares are owned by institutional investors. Comparatively, 1.9% of Prudential Public shares are owned by institutional investors. 1.0% of Brookfield Reinsurance shares are owned by insiders. Comparatively, 0.1% of Prudential Public shares are owned by ins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that endowments, large money managers and hedge funds believe a stock is poised for long-term growth.

Brookfield Reinsurance has a beta of 1.53, meaning that its share price is 53% more vol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, Prudential Public has a beta of 1.04, meaning that its share price is 4% more volatile than the S&P 500.

Brookfield Reinsurance pays an annual dividend of $0.32 per share and has a dividend yield of 0.4%. Prudential Public pays an annual dividend of $0.29 per share and has a dividend yield of 1.0%. Brookfield Reinsurance pays out 110.3% of its earnings in the form of a dividend, suggesting it may not have sufficient earnings to cover its dividend payment in the future. Prudential Public pays out 12.5% of its earnings in the form of a dividend. Prudential Public is clearly the better dividend stock, given its higher yield and lower payout ratio.
